ANVER SLSA-3 spring loaded vacuum cup suspension assembly

Softens the attach and increases vacuum cup life. ANVER vacuum cups can be mounted to most vacuum systems using spring loaded suspension assemblies – high quality, well finished assemblies designed for high speed automation applications.

Adjustable bulkhead fittings mount to almost any lifting frame, while a variety of tube fittings connect the assembly to the vacuum generating system. These mounting systems act as extensions while providing support when handling a load.

This is the largest of the SLSA range: the SLSA-3 series takes a 1/4″ NPT male thread with travel to 120 mm, and the SLSA-4 adds a G 3/8″ version for the larger cups and pads.

Advantages of Suspension Assemblies

01 – Less machine indexing

Reduces machine indexing when picking material up from a stack.

02 – Height compensation

Compensates for variations in object height and gives a soft touch attach.

03 – Less shock and noise

Minimises shock and noise to both the object and the machine.

04 – Longer cup life

Provides consistent cup pressure on each pick-up, which increases cup life.

05 – Simple interface

An easy way for the vacuum cup and vacuum lines to interface with machine tooling.

06 – Stainless steel rod

The suspension rod and springs are stainless steel throughout – a step up from the plated steel tube used on the smaller series.

The SLSA-3838G-102 is the suspension used with the larger VP and FP pads and the PFC 3/8G-F panel cups. It has short travel but takes a much thicker mounting plate – up to 1.25 in. (31.8 mm).

Slide suspensions clamp onto a crossarm rather than through a panel hole, so the cup position can be slid along the arm and locked. Choose by crossarm size: 1.75 in. (44 mm) or 2.00 in. (51 mm) square.

Tube Fittings

Tube fittings are purchased separately to connect the spring loaded suspension assembly to the vacuum hose. They are available in barbed, push-in and compression connections, in straight, elbow and tee configurations, and accept tubes with standard inside and outside diameters.

All fittings are electroless nickel plated. The HS14-14M-G is the part that lets a G 1/4″ cup thread – such as the PFC 1/4G-F panel cups – mount to an SLSA-3 suspension.

Thread note – the “G” thread is also known as BSPP, and is commonly used worldwide for vacuum applications.

Smaller sizes – the SLSA-2 series takes a G 1/8″ male thread, and the SLSA-1 series an M5 / 10-32 UNF female thread.
